It seems that I am making a habit of this but after last years dearth of acorns looks like this year they are once again in abundance. Noticed a lot of oaks with very heavy crop in Devon two weeks ago. This weekend whilst out after tree rats in places it felt like I was walking on marbles and large no's of pigeon under oaks on newly sown grass and wheat were feeding on acorns as were the pheasants. Looks like the rape will be safe for a few months. Also huge no's of pigeon on standing maize which is unusual, we still have a lot to be cut and looks like it will stay that way for a few more weeks its going to be too wet to get on the ground if the forecast is correct.
